What is an SEO Brief and Why Do You Need One?
An SEO brief is a document that details the objectives for a particular search engine ranking effort. Think of it as a guide – it defines the boundaries of the task and ensures everyone is on the same page . Without one, understanding can fail , producing wasted resources . A good brief contains specifics such as relevant search terms , competitive landscape , expected results , and the overall strategy – ultimately making the campaign more efficient and successful .

Developing Successful Article Guides: A Step-by-Step Process
Creating a well-defined article brief is essential for securing agreement between producers and the marketing group. Here's a practical step-by-step process to guide you across the development method. First, define your target reader. Then, establish the primary goal of the content. Next, detail the anticipated tone, search terms, and format. Reflect on including a suggested subject and pertinent examples. Finally, provide clear achievement indicators to assess the article's effectiveness.
